Output d26c1ccca94636afc0f7ac70e9b41c793623b7a36cdfb18d203d818495174387:0

value
865364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 906da038fd3ae9abd1da58b450f7bbabadc5bf7c OP_EQUAL
address
3ErgZ77oXCufuFXhiCmtTYwQqQEwrTwfhy
transaction
d26c1ccca94636afc0f7ac70e9b41c793623b7a36cdfb18d203d818495174387
spent
true